The Shishmaref Northern Lights scored the most points they've had all season to find success on Thursday. They breezed by White Mountain on the road to the tune of 89-57. The victory was nothing new for Shishmaref as they're now sitting on six straight.
Shishmaref found their leader in underclassman Ivan Davis-Nayokpuk, who scored 24 points. Colton Hadley was another key contributor, scoring 17 points.
Shishmaref's win bumped their record up to 7-4. As for White Mountain, they are on a three-game losing streak that has dropped them down to 4-5.
Shishmaref won't have much time to rest: their next match is against the Malamutes at 4:30 p.m. on February 2nd. White Mountain does not have any more games scheduled as of now.
